Ralston is a city located in Carroll County, Iowa. Ralston has a 2025 population of 75. Ralston is currently declining at a rate of -1.32% annually and its population has decreased by -5.06%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 79 in 2020.
The average household income in Ralston is $72,361 with a poverty rate of 21.21%.The median age in Ralston is 41.8 years: 41.4 years for males, and 53.8 years for females.

The racial composition of Ralston includes 92.42% White, and smaller percentages for and multiracial populations.
Race | Population | Percentage (of total) |
---|---|---|
White | 61 | 92.42% |
Two or more races | 5 | 7.58% |

Ralston's average per capita income is $57,500. Household income levels show a median of $67,500. The poverty rate stands at 21.21%.
Name | Median | Mean |
---|---|---|
Married Families | $74,375 | - |
Households | $67,500 | $72,361 |
Families | $56,250 | $69,491 |
Non Families | $33,750 | $55,467 |
